Like crack, but spelled by someone actually on it.
ya dude i love crak!!
by NotARapist April 24, 2005
A word for whit or humour.
Jimmy says "why did the chicken cross the road,to get to the other side"

"you have no crak"
by sdhguishgui September 25, 2008
A name for an addicting game or hobby. play this so much you are an addict
*my freind joe plays runescape too much it is his *crak*
by jeremy o_0 October 21, 2003